python之解决pycharm:External file changes sync may be slow: The current inotify(7) watch limit is too l

1.检查当前设置

$ cat /proc/sys/fs/inotify/max_user_watches

8192

2.当前值太小,添加新的conf文件, 打开文件并添加以下内容:

# Set inotify watch limit high enough for IntelliJ IDEA (PhpStorm, PyCharm, RubyMine, WebStorm).
# Create this file as /etc/sysctl.d/60-jetbrains.conf (Debian, Ubuntu), and
# run `sudo service procps start` or reboot.
# Source: https://confluence.jetbrains.com/display/IDEADEV/Inotify+Watches+Limit
# 
# More information resources:
# -$ man inotify # manpage
# -$ man sysctl.conf # manpage
# -$ cat /proc/sys/fs/inotify/max_user_watches # print current value in use

fs.inotify.max_user_watches = 524288

3.重新启动系统

$ sudo sysctl -p --system

 

  • 0
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
这个错误提示表明虚拟环境中的python.exe文件无法正常运行。根据引用中的报错信息,可能有以下几个原因导致这个问题出现: 1. 虚拟环境创建失败:这可能是由于系统或可执行文件不兼容导致的。如果之前在"仅为此用户安装"的模式下安装了Python,或者在系统中安装了多个Python版本,可能会出现这个错误。解决方法是将合适版本的PythonXX.dll复制到虚拟环境的Scripts/目录中。 2. Python环境问题:根据引用的描述,发现将python3.exe复制到其他路径后仍然无法运行,说明Python环境存在问题。默认路径下正常运行可能是因为系统会从C:\Windows\system32目录下加载所需的vcruntime140.dll文件。 要解决这个问题,可以尝试以下方法: - 确保虚拟环境创建过程中使用的Python版本与PyCharm中配置的Python版本匹配。 - 检查系统环境变量中是否设置了正确的Python路径,以及是否包含了重复的Python路径。 - 检查虚拟环境中是否缺少所需的依赖文件,如vcruntime140.dll等。 - 如果是在PyCharm中出现这个错误,可以尝试重新安装低版本的Python,确保与PyCharm版本兼容。同时,确保在PyCharm中选择正确的虚拟环境。 总之,这个问题通常是由于Python环境配置不正确或环境不兼容导致的。通过检查和调整Python环境的配置,可以解决这个问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值